Glad the plugs and coils helped. It may not be because the coils are aftermarket, but just because they're new. Having proper ignition will improve everything about the engine's running and restore the boost and airflow, which is why you're now hearing the full effect of the turbo and exhaust. Having airflow mods won't cause you to run lean - MAF, O2s, and MAP sensor (if your car is an 01+) monitor the airflow and allow the ECU to compensate for the higher flow.
